ADHD in Children
Children with untreated ADHD can have significant problems in school, at home and in social situations. This can cause low self-esteem, frustration, stress and friction in the family. It can also make it difficult for children to get along with other children and develop healthy relationships.
It is important for parents to seek help when they think their child has ADHD because treatment can significantly improve the quality of life for children with the disorder and the rest of the family. The symptoms of the condition can be managed with medication, therapy and lifestyle changes.
Often children with ADHD are misdiagnosed because the symptoms can look similar to the symptoms of other medical and behavioural conditions. For example, learning disabilities, depression or anxiety, major life events, sleep disorders and thyroid problems can all cause a person to have symptoms that appear like ADHD.
In order to be diagnosed with ADHD, a person must show six or more symptoms of inattention and/or six or more symptoms of hyperactivity-impulsivity for at least six months. These symptoms must have lasted longer than usual and they must interfere with the person’s ability to function in different settings (home, school and social situations).
The symptoms of ADHD can be different for everyone and they are usually seen in boys and men more than girls and women. However, a person can still have ADHD when they are a girl or assigned female at birth (AFAB). It can be harder to diagnose AFAB and children of colour with ADHD because some medical professionals have preconceived ideas about what people with the condition ‘look like’.

Comprehending Pancreatic Cancer
Pancreatic cancer is one of the most deadly types of cancer, mainly due to its late medical diagnosis and aggressive nature. The pancreas is an important organ responsible for producing enzymes that help digestion and hormones such as insulin, which regulates blood sugar level levels. When cancer develops in the pancreas, it can interrupt these important functions and result in serious health problems.
Danger Factors for Pancreatic Cancer
While the specific cause of pancreatic cancer remains uncertain, a number of threat elements have actually been identified:
- Age: The threat increases substantially for individuals over the age of 60.
- Smoking: Tobacco use is one of the most considerable risk aspects for developing pancreatic cancer.
- Obesity: Excess body weight has actually been associated with a greater danger of various cancers, consisting of pancreatic.
- Household History: Genetic predispositions can contribute in developing pancreatic cancer.
- Chronic Pancreatitis: Long-term swelling of the pancreas can increase cancer risk.
The Railroad Industry and Health Risks
Railroad workers are often exposed to various hazardous substances, including carcinogens, that may elevate their danger of establishing health conditions, including pancreatic cancer. Some potential exposures particular to the railroad market consist of:
- Asbestos: Historically used in insulating products, asbestos direct exposure has actually been linked to different cancers.
- Benzene: Commonly utilized in the production of fuels, direct exposure to benzene has actually been related to numerous kinds of cancer.
- Diesel Exhaust: Prolonged exposure to diesel fumes is a recognized danger aspect for respiratory problems and certain cancers, consisting of pancreatic cancer.

Comprehending Lymphoma
Lymphoma is a type of cancer that comes from in the lymphatic system, which belongs to the body's body immune system. There are 2 main kinds of lymphoma:
Hodgkin Lymphoma: Characterized by the existence of Reed-Sternberg cells, this type of lymphoma is typically more treatable and has a higher survival rate.
Non-Hodgkin Lymphoma (NHL): This incorporates a diverse group of blood cancers that consist of any lymphoma other than Hodgkin's. NHL can be aggressive and varies widely in terms of prognosis and treatment.

Waiting at various times
ADHD is a mental health condition characterised by hyperactivity, inattention, and an impulsiveness. These symptoms can affect anyone, but are more prominent in children and young people. However the majority of people aren't diagnosed with the disorder until they are older. In the process, the number of adults seeking diagnosis on the NHS has seen a dramatic increase. This is largely due to the growing awareness of the disorder but also due to an insufficient supply of services. The wait times for ADHD assessments on the NHS are currently long. In some cases, people have waited for more than four years to be seen. A Freedom of Information request by ADHD UK found that adults in Northern Ireland were waiting the longest, followed by Wales and England.
Experts have expressed concern about the increasing demand for private ADHD assessments. They argue that the BBC's Panorama investigation has revealed private clinics providing unreliable diagnoses to patients who are vulnerable. Others have suggested that the report has exposed the inaccessibility of public health services for ADHD.
